The phrase "about a preparation"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the details or context surrounding a specific preparation, such as in cooking, planning, or organizing an event.
Example: "The book provides valuable insights about a preparation for the upcoming exam, including study tips and time management strategies."
Alternatives: "regarding a preparation" or "concerning a preparation".
